Cultural Attractions in Los Angeles California

  1. Low-angle view of the Getty Center's modern architecture with curved lines and glass windows.
    Los Angeles

    Getty Center

    The Getty Center, a sprawling complex in Brentwood, is renowned for its collection of European paintings, sculptures, and decorative arts. It is equally known for the stunning architecture of its buildings, designed by Richard Meier, and its breathtaking gardens.

    1
  2. The Griffith Observatory with Los Angeles skyline backdrop at sunset, showcasing urban architecture.
    Los Angeles

    Griffith Observatory

    Situated on Mount Hollywood, Griffith Observatory offers stunning views of the city and the stars. The observatory is also a gateway to the beautiful Griffith Park, a large municipal park at the eastern end of the Santa Monica Mountains.

    2
  3. Los Angeles

    Hollywood Walk of Fame

    The Hollywood Walk of Fame, located along 15 blocks of Hollywood Boulevard and three blocks of Vine Street, is a must-visit for movie buffs. It has stars embedded in the sidewalk honoring more than 2,600 celebrities for their contributions to the entertainment industry.

    3
  4. A stunning aerial shot of Griffith Observatory overlooking Los Angeles cityscape and greenery.
    Los Angeles

    Los Angeles County Museum

    The Los Angeles County Museum of Art (LACMA) is the largest art museum in the western United States, holding more than 150,000 works spanning the history of art from ancient times to the present.

    4
  5. Aerial drone shot capturing the iconic architecture of downtown Los Angeles, featuring The Broad museum.
    Los Angeles

    The Broad

    The Broad is a contemporary art museum in Downtown Los Angeles. The museum offers free general admission and has a prominent collection of post-war and contemporary art, with nearly 2,000 works of modern and contemporary art.
